Convenient print functions Matching Colors Using Utility Software Network Setup Encrypting communications (IPSec) Manipulation prevention and encryption between the PC (client) and printer are possible at the network level. Memo zz The IKE protocol supported by the device is "IKEv1". The communications mode supported by the device is "Transport mode". "Tunnel mode" is not operational. If IPSec is enabled, printer response may be slow depending on the network communications status. Note zz IPSec cannot operate with mail sending functions and SNMP Trap functions. Setup flow Set up the printer before setting the PC. Printer setup Use the web, and follow the procedure to enable IPSec. 1 Log in as an administrator. Reference zz See "Logging in as an administrator" (P.230). 2 Click [Admin Setup]>[Network Setup]>[Security] tab. Setting the network from the web browser 3 Click the [IPSec] tab. 1 2 4 Enable [IPSec] in "STEP1". 3 Note zz When IPSec is "Enable", communications from the PC with the IP address set in "STEP2" will be encrypted. 4 zz If IPSec settings fail because the set parameters and PC do not match, etc., opening the web page will be disabled. In this case, either disable [IPSec] in the network settings from the device control panel, or disable IPSec by implementing network initialization. 5 Appendix Index 5 Enter the host IP address in "STEP2". Note zz Use the IP address to specify the host that authorizes the printing and setup. zz For the IPv4 address, use single-byte numbers separated by "." zz For the IPv6 global address, use single-byte alphanumerics separated by "."
